Innovations in eco-friendly packaging materials
The quest for sustainable e-commerce begins, for many, with packaging. Traditional packaging materials like single-use plastics and excessive cardboard contribute significantly to waste and pollution. However, a wave of innovation is introducing viable and often superior alternatives that meet both environmental and logistical needs. This evolution is crucial for reducing ecological impact.
From biodegradable plastics derived from plant starches to mushroom-based composites that offer remarkable protective qualities, the options are expanding rapidly. Companies are also exploring ways to use recycled content more effectively, not just in secondary packaging but also in primary product containers. The goal is to create packaging that is either reusable, recyclable, compostable, or made from renewable resources.
Key advancements in packaging innovation
- Compostable polymers: Materials that break down into natural elements, leaving no toxic residue.
- Recycled content maximization: Utilizing post-consumer and post-industrial waste in packaging.
- Bio-based alternatives: Packaging derived from agricultural byproducts, seaweed, or fungi.
- Minimalist design: Reducing overall material usage while maintaining product safety.
These new materials not only address environmental concerns but also present opportunities for brands to tell a compelling sustainability story. Packaging can become a tactile representation of a company’s values, enhancing the unboxing experience while aligning with consumer expectations for eco-conscious choices. The challenge lies in scaling these innovations and making them cost-effective for widespread adoption across the e-commerce sector.
The rise of green shipping and logistics
Beyond packaging, the transportation of goods represents a significant area for environmental improvement in sustainable e-commerce. Green shipping and logistics are rapidly gaining traction as businesses seek to minimize their carbon footprint from warehouse to doorstep. This involves a multi-faceted approach, integrating technology, strategic planning, and alternative energy sources to optimize delivery routes and modes.
The adoption of electric vehicles for last-mile delivery, the optimization of warehouse energy consumption, and the consolidation of shipments to reduce empty space are just a few examples of current initiatives. Furthermore, companies are investing in more efficient routing software and exploring partnerships with logistics providers that offer carbon-neutral shipping options. The aim is to create a more streamlined and environmentally responsible supply chain.

Strategies for sustainable delivery
- Route optimization: Using algorithms to minimize travel distance and fuel consumption.
- Electric vehicle fleets: Transitioning to EVs for urban and last-mile deliveries.
- Consolidated shipping: Reducing the number of packages and trips.
- Renewable energy in logistics: Powering warehouses and distribution centers with solar or wind energy.
The shift towards greener logistics is not without its challenges, including infrastructure development for EV charging and the initial investment in new technologies. However, the long-term benefits, including reduced operational costs, enhanced brand reputation, and compliance with evolving environmental regulations, make it a crucial area of focus for e-commerce businesses.
Circular economy principles in e-commerce
The concept of a circular economy, which emphasizes reducing waste and maximizing resource utility, is gaining significant traction within sustainable e-commerce. Instead of the traditional linear model of ‘take, make, dispose,’ businesses are now exploring ways to design products and processes that keep materials in use for as long as possible. This paradigm shift offers immense potential for environmental and economic benefits.
For e-commerce, this means looking at product lifecycles, encouraging repair and refurbishment, and establishing robust return and recycling programs. It also involves designing packaging that can be easily returned and reused, or that is made from materials that can be endlessly recycled. The goal is to move towards a system where waste is minimized, and resources are continually re-integrated into the economy.
Implementing circular strategies
- Product-as-a-service models: Offering products for rent or lease rather than outright purchase.
- Take-back programs: Companies collecting used products for recycling or refurbishment.
- Reusable packaging systems: Developing closed-loop systems for packaging return and reuse.
- Waste reduction at source: Designing products with longevity and recyclability in mind.
Embracing circular economy principles requires a fundamental re-evaluation of business models and supply chains. It often involves collaboration with customers, suppliers, and even competitors to create effective closed-loop systems. While complex, the move towards circularity is seen as a key component of truly sustainable e-commerce, offering a path to long-term resilience and resource efficiency.
Technology’s role in driving sustainability
Technology is an indispensable ally in the pursuit of sustainable e-commerce. From artificial intelligence and machine learning to blockchain and IoT, these tools are providing unprecedented opportunities to optimize operations, enhance transparency, and reduce environmental impact across the entire value chain. Their application is making green initiatives more efficient and measurable.
AI, for instance, can predict demand more accurately, reducing overproduction and waste, while also optimizing delivery routes to minimize fuel consumption. Blockchain technology offers a secure and transparent way to track products from origin to consumer, verifying ethical sourcing and sustainable production practices. IoT sensors can monitor environmental conditions in warehouses and during transit, ensuring product integrity and preventing spoilage.
Technological enablers for green e-commerce
- AI-driven demand forecasting: Minimizing inventory waste and optimizing production.
- Blockchain for supply chain transparency: Verifying ethical sourcing and carbon footprint.
- IoT for smart logistics: Real-time tracking and condition monitoring to reduce waste.
- Big data analytics: Identifying inefficiencies and areas for environmental improvement.
These technological advancements are not merely about efficiency; they are about enabling a new level of accountability and informed decision-making. By leveraging data and automation, e-commerce businesses can identify key areas for improvement, track their progress towards sustainability goals, and communicate their efforts transparently to a discerning consumer base. This integration of tech is vital for future success.
